Understanding Pain Relief Capsules
Pain relief capsules are oral medications designed to minimize various types of physical pain. Compared to liquids or topical creams, capsules provide distinct benefits:
- Convenience: They are simple to carry and need no measurement.
- Dose Accuracy: Each pill contains an exact quantity of active pharmaceutical components (APIs).
- Taste Masking: Capsules encase bitter medications, making them much easier to swallow.
- Extended Release: Some advanced solutions permit sluggish release of the medication over several hours.
Generally, over the counter (OTC) pain relief capsules fall into a couple of primary chemical categories, each working differently within the body.

Not all pain is produced equivalent, and neither is every pill. Picking the appropriate product depends greatly on the source and nature of the pain.
1. For Inflammatory Pain (Joints, Muscles, Injuries)
If the pain stems from swelling-- such as tendonitis, a sprained ankle, or arthritis-- NSAIDs like ibuprofen or naproxen are generally the preferred option. Because they target the source of swelling (swelling and tissue irritation), they tend to be more efficient for musculoskeletal issues than standard analgesics.
2. For General Aches and Fevers
When dealing with a fever, basic despair, or moderate headaches Painkillers Without Prescription substantial swelling, acetaminophen is often advised. It is likewise the go-to alternative for people who have delicate stomachs or a history of intestinal bleeding, which can be intensified by NSAIDs.
3. For Migraines and Severe Headaches
Specialized mix pills often work best for migraines. These formulas often bundle acetaminophen, aspirin, and a small dosage of caffeine. The caffeine not just restricts blood vessels in the brain (assisting to minimize headache pain) however likewise speeds up the absorption of the primary pain-relieving components.
Finest Practices for Safe Consumption
While pain relief pills are commonly readily available without a prescription, they are still potent medications that need cautious handling. Abuse can lead to severe health issues.
- Constantly Read the Label: Check the active ingredients, recommended dosage, and maximum day-to-day limitations. Double-dosing can happen accidentally if a person takes a cold medication that includes acetaminophen along with a dedicated pain pill.
- Mind the Duration: OTC Pain Relief Drugs reducers are implied for short-term relief. If pain continues for more than a few days (or a fever lasts more than 3 days), it is crucial to seek advice from a healthcare specialist.
- Think About Pre-existing Conditions: Individuals with hypertension, kidney illness, liver problems, or a history of stomach ulcers need to speak with a medical professional before taking certain Pain Relief Supplements For Sale pills.
- Stay Hydrated: Taking pills with a full glass of water helps ensure correct dissolution and reduces the threat of the pill lodging in the esophagus or aggravating the stomach lining.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: Can I take ibuprofen and acetaminophen together?
A: Yes, under particular circumstances, physicians might recommend alternating in between ibuprofen and acetaminophen since they belong to different drug classes and work by means of different mechanisms. Nevertheless, users should never ever combine them without expert medical assistance to avoid unintentional overdose or stress on the liver and kidneys.
Q2: Are liquid-filled gel pills faster-acting than conventional tough tablets?
A: Generally, yes. Liquid-filled softgel pills typically liquify faster in the stomach than compressed hard tablets, which can lead to quicker absorption of the active ingredient into the bloodstream.
Q3: Can long-term use of pain relief pills be damaging?
A: Yes. Extended or excessive use of NSAIDs can lead to intestinal bleeding, ulcers, and kidney issues. Long-term overuse of acetaminophen can cause serious, in some cases irreversible liver damage. Always utilize the lowest reliable dose for the fastest possible period.
Q4: Should I take pain relief pills on an empty stomach?
A: It depends on the active ingredient. NSAIDs (like ibuprofen and naproxen) can irritate the stomach lining and are best taken with food, milk, or an antacid. Acetaminophen is generally less irritating to the stomach and can usually be taken with or without food.
